Introducción a la planificación Scrum

Para gestionar un proyecto, se requiere un marco. Aquí es donde se introduce Scrum. La forma ágil en que se gestiona un proyecto, más específicamente un desarrollo de software, se llama Scrum. Hay muchos procesos ágiles y scrum es uno de ellos. En este tema, aprenderemos sobre la planificación de Scrum y algunas herramientas de scrum que pueden hacer que el trabajo sea más eficiente

Un elemento importante en scrum es el propietario del producto . Esta es la persona que sabe cuál es la función del producto, ya que él es quien administra el negocio. Las características que deben incluirse o excluirse siempre deben discutirse con él.

Aquí el dueño del producto es el cliente. Hay un jefe de equipo scrum por un maestro scrum que se asegura de que el equipo trabaje en conjunto, dando los mejores resultados y cumpliendo con las reglas de Scrum. El tiempo, así como el dinero, se ahorra al usar Scrum. Si el equipo se elige correctamente y el método se sigue correctamente, el resultado puede ser muy productivo. Este software puede beneficiar a numerosas organizaciones, ya que hace que los miembros del equipo sean más eficientes, hay más transparencia entre ellos y el trabajo se lleva a cabo de manera más organizada.

Se decide el número de días necesarios para completar el trabajo que figura en la lista de pedidos pendientes y esto se conoce como Sprints . De esta manera, el progreso en esa tarea se puede medir correctamente y se hace más fácil mantenerse en el camino.

El equipo scrum se reúne todos los días para discutir su progreso y resolver cualquier problema que pueda surgir durante el proceso. Tales reuniones se llaman Daily Scrums .

¿Cómo funciona la planificación Scrum?

El propietario del producto decide la prioridad del trabajo que debe llevarse a cabo primero y, por lo tanto, se realiza una acumulación de productos. Contiene todo lo que se requiere. Después de seleccionar el trabajo, tienen que completar el trabajo dentro del sprint. También se estima el tiempo necesario para completar ese trabajo. Los miembros se reúnen todos los días para discutir el progreso y los obstáculos, si los hay.

Herramientas Scrum

Analicemos algunas herramientas de scrum que pueden hacer que el trabajo sea más eficiente:

1) Backlog

La cartera de pedidos es la clave más importante aquí. Aquí se enumeran todas las tareas que deben realizarse y los requisitos para lograr el producto final. Cualquier tarea que sea más importante y deba completarse primero debe tener prioridad en esta lista de tareas pendientes. Hay dos tipos de retrasos:

  • Project Backlog es una lista de todas las cosas que deben hacerse para completar el proyecto emprendido.
  • Sprint Backlog son las historias y tareas de los usuarios que se han tomado del backlog del proyecto y se han completado en un sprint. Los elementos se pueden mover desde el primer trabajo acumulado al siguiente según la prioridad. Los beneficios de lo anterior son:
  1. Los sprints de los equipos pueden ser organizados y planificados de manera más eficiente por los gerentes.
  2. Cualquier cambio realizado puede estar en el cronograma o cualquier asunto compartido con el equipo.
  3. Se ahorra tiempo y trabajo ya que no hay posibilidad de repetir la entrada.

2) Historias de usuarios

Las historias de usuarios son la forma en que el equipo scrum determina el progreso realizado por ellos. Se forma una historia de usuario de acuerdo con el punto de vista del cliente que debe completarse en un sprint. Luego se divide en partes como la tarea que debe hacerse, los problemas que pueden surgir y los problemas que deben resolverse.

Se otorgan puntos a estas historias de usuarios sobre la base del esfuerzo y el tiempo invertidos en el proyecto, así como la habilidad utilizada. A uno complicado se le dan más puntos. Las historias de usuarios son beneficiosas ya que los requisitos del proyecto son más refinados y la entrada de datos más precisa.

3) Gráfico de Burndown

Para rastrear cuánto se ha logrado en el proyecto, se utiliza un gráfico. Es el gráfico de Burndown . Una vez que se completa un sprint, se actualiza en este cuadro. Existen diferentes formas de medir y comparar el progreso del proyecto, como puntos, puntos, la cantidad de días que se tarda en completar el proyecto, etc. En este cuadro, el eje y muestra las historias de los usuarios que deben completarse y la x -eje del tiempo necesario.

Un buen gráfico muestra una pendiente que va hacia abajo, lo que significa que las tareas se están completando. Cuando sube, significa que se están agregando tareas. Si el gráfico es horizontal, denota que el trabajo no se ha completado en el tiempo dado. Mantener el gráfico obliga al equipo a seguir actualizando su rendimiento. Se ahorra mucho tiempo ya que los gráficos no se crean manualmente sino por el software.

4) Panel de tareas

Cada tarea se representa visualmente en un Panel de tareas . Cualquier miembro del equipo puede optar por escribir en él mencionando el nivel de finalización, el trabajo que aún está pendiente, las pruebas que se puedan tomar o cualquier otro punto que valga la pena mencionar.

Cuando finaliza el sprint, el equipo puede verificar el tiempo necesario para completar el proyecto, el trabajo que no se pudo completar y la razón por la que no se pudo completar. El tablero de tareas se puede utilizar para establecer plazos para todo el proyecto, así como para un trabajo en particular. Esto aumenta la eficiencia.

5) Gráficos de velocidad

El trabajo completado durante todo el proceso se mide mediante tablas de velocidad . El número de puntos de historia se denota en el eje y y el número de sprints en el eje x. Se suman todos los puntos completados por el equipo y se calcula el promedio. Esto se conoce como velocidad.

La ventaja de este cuadro es que decidir la fecha de finalización del proyecto se vuelve más fácil para el gerente, incluso si el cliente realiza cambios. Al estudiar el trabajo anterior realizado, el equipo puede decidir con mayor precisión el trabajo que pueden hacer en los próximos proyectos.

Estas herramientas de scrum son beneficiosas en una organización, ya que los gráficos incluidos aquí hacen que todo el proceso sea muy transparente, aumentando la productividad. El equipo puede aprovechar al máximo su tiempo y, dado que el rendimiento se verifica regularmente, también aumenta la precisión.

Artículos recomendados

Esta ha sido una guía para la planificación de Scrum. Aquí hemos discutido la planificación y la descripción general de cómo funciona Scrum con algunas herramientas de Scrum que pueden hacer que el trabajo sea más eficiente. También puede consultar nuestros otros artículos sugeridos para obtener más información:

  1. Introducción a las prácticas ágiles
  2. Guía de programación ágil
  3. Aprende Scrum con Jira
  4. ¿Qué es el CRM ágil?
  5. Evaluación abierta de Scrum